Abstract

PURPOSE:To modify the interior of walls, ceiling surfaces, etc., rapidly at low cost. CONSTITUTION:At an end of a mounting surface 20, a gap 27 is provided between said end and a surface 25 normal to the surface 20 and a plurality of fixing devices 1 having a locking groove 3 extending in the londitudinal direction are fixed in advance to the mounting surface of a frame of building, thereby providing an insertion opening 8 on the extended line. The periphery of a square panel is bent inwardly to form a box-like interior panel 10 having a locking section 12. Each locking section 12 of the panels 10 is inserted into each groove 3 of the fixing devices 1 from the opening 8 in succession so that the panels 10 are fixed to the surface 20.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a method for constructing walls and ceilings using interior panels that cover walls and ceilings.

[Prior Art] Traditionally, interior materials used for the interior of buildings, such as walls, partitions, indoor advertising boards, and ceiling surfaces, include cloth, tiles, decorative boards, etc., and these interior materials are pasted. Methods such as these have been used to directly attach them to foundation materials such as building walls.

[Problem to be solved by the invention] However, with such conventional wall and ceiling construction methods, when renovating walls, etc., it is necessary to remove not only the previous interior material but also the underlying material. There was a problem in that not only was it impossible to reuse the interior materials and base materials that were needed and removed, but also that the removal work and restoration required a lot of cost and construction time.

[0004] This invention was made to solve the above problem, and its purpose is to provide walls and ceilings that can be renovated quickly and inexpensively.
This paper attempts to provide a construction method for ceiling surfaces.

[Function] In the wall and ceiling construction method of the present invention, when fixing an interior panel to a mounting surface, the interior panel can be locked and fixed by sequentially fitting the locking portions of the interior panel into the locking grooves of the mounting fittings.

On the other hand, at the time of renovation, the old interior panels can be sequentially removed from the locking grooves of the mounting fittings, and the new interior panels can be locked and fixed by sequentially inserting them.

First, the fixing structure of an interior panel fixed to a wall surface by the construction method of this embodiment will be explained with reference to FIGS. 1 to 5.

This fixing structure is mainly composed of a mounting bracket 1 and an interior panel 10, and further includes a mounting bracket 5.
and a baseboard panel 15 are used.

[0011] The mounting bracket 1 is formed by extrusion molding of aluminum material, for example. This mounting bracket 1 has an irregular C-shape in cross section, and is provided with a slit 2 extending in the longitudinal direction on the front side, and locking grooves 3, 3 that are orthogonal to the slit 2 and communicate with each other. are provided extending in the longitudinal direction. A plurality of attachment holes 4 are bored on the back side.

The interior panel 10 is formed into a rectangular shape by a laminated plate made of, for example, iron or non-ferrous metal and plastic, and a peripheral edge portion 11 is formed by bending the periphery by pressing with a press. Also, the opposing peripheral edge 11
Locking portions 12, 12 that can be bent inward and fitted into the locking groove 3 of the mounting bracket 1 are formed at the tip of the fitting. The flat surface of the interior panel 10 is decorated with an appropriate exterior design.

The mounting bracket 5 is a member for fixing one end of the interior panel 10 and the baseboard panel 15, and is formed by shortening the above-mentioned mounting bracket 1, and has a similar slit 2 and locking groove 3. ing.

The baseboard panel 15 is made of the same material as the interior panel 10, and locking portions (not shown) similar to the locking portions 12 described above are formed at the left and right ends extending in the horizontal direction. .

Next, a construction method for walls and ceiling surfaces will be explained with reference to FIGS. 1 to 8.

First, the interior panel 10 is placed between the building frame 20, which is the mounting surface, and the ceiling 25, which is the orthogonal surface.
A gap 27 is formed into which the material can be inserted.

Next, the plurality of mounting brackets 5 are fixed to the building frame 20 with mounting screws 7 at a predetermined height from the floor surface and with a predetermined gap maintained in the horizontal direction.

Next, the mounting brackets 1 are fixed to the building frame 20 on the extension line above each of the mounting brackets 5 with the mounting screws 7,
The mounting bracket 1 is further fixed to the building frame 20 while leaving a gap for forming the insertion opening 8 on the upward extension line of the mounting bracket 1. At this time, the upper end of the upper mounting bracket 1 is located at approximately the same height as the ceiling 25 surface, and the interval between the insertion openings 8 is set to be slightly smaller than the vertical dimension of the interior panel 10. In addition,
If the ceiling 25 has not been constructed yet, the height of the ceiling 25 will be the planned ceiling position. As a result, the plurality of mounting brackets 1 and 5 are
They are fixed to the building frame 20 in parallel in the vertical direction with a predetermined interval maintained.

Next, the locking portions at both ends of the baseboard panel 15 are fitted into the locking grooves 3, 3 of the mounting fittings 5, and the baseboard panel 15 is fixed to the lowest part of the building frame 20.

Furthermore, the locking portions 12, 12 of the interior panel 10
are inserted into the locking grooves 3 of the mounting bracket 1 that are parallel to each other below the insertion opening 8 and dropped, and the required number of interior panels 10 are sequentially stacked on the baseboard panel 15 to remove the mounting bracket 1. (See Figure 7).

On the other hand, in the mounting bracket 1 above the insertion opening 8, as shown in FIG. increase. Then, the last interior panel 10 is fitted with the upper part of the locking part 12 into the upper mounting bracket 1, and the lower part of the locking part 12 is inserted into the locking groove 3 of the lower mounting bracket 1. Stop. At this time, the upper part of the uppermost interior panel 10 is inserted into the gap 27, and the plurality of interior panels 10 are stacked on top of the baseboard panel 15 via the plurality of mounting brackets 1 due to their own weight and are assembled into a building frame. It is fixed at 20. Note that the height of the insertion opening 8 is preferably set at around 1.5 m in consideration of workability. Also, gap 2
7, a gasket 29 may be interposed between the interior panel 10 and the ceiling 25.

Further, adjacent to the group of 10 interior panels that are locked and fixed in this way, one of the above-mentioned mounting brackets 1 and 5 and the mounting brackets 1 and 5 are installed vertically in parallel with each other at a predetermined interval.
Fix 5. A plurality of interior panels 10 are locked and fixed between the mounting brackets 1 and 5 as described above, and the building frame 20 is interiorized with the multiple interior panels 10. At this time, in the mounting bracket 1, the peripheral edges 11 of the adjacent interior panels 10, 10 are closely fixed to each other.

On the other hand, when renovating a wall, first, a suction cup is sucked onto the surface of the interior panel 10 located at the insertion opening 8 portion. Then, the interior panel 10 is lifted a little to release the engagement with the mounting bracket 1 at the lower part of the locking part 12, and the interior panel 10 is further pulled down toward the user to be removed from the upper and lower mounting brackets 1. Next, the interior panels 10 that are locked to the upper mounting bracket 1 are successively pulled down and removed through the insertion opening 8.

Next, the interior panels 10 that are locked to the lower mounting bracket 1 are successively pushed up and removed from the insertion opening 8.

[0025] After all the previous interior panels 10 fixed to the building frame 20 via the mounting brackets 1 are removed, the interior panels 10 with the new exterior design are locked and fixed by the method described above. be exposed.

[Effects of the invention] As described above, according to the wall and ceiling construction method of the present invention, interior panels can be easily installed and fixed without directly attaching them to the mounting surface of a building with nails, bolts, etc. and can be quickly and easily replaced and refurbished with new interior panels.

Furthermore, during renovation, there is no need to remove the previous mounting surface base material, etc., and the cost and construction period for removal work and restoration can be reduced.
